SCELC FOLIO is a multi-year, opt-in initiative that provides SCELC Member libraries with affordable, scalable access to the open-source FOLIO library services platform. Delivered in partnership with EBSCO Information Services, the pilot offers centralized implementation, hosting, and ongoing support.
During the initial pilot phase, SCELC anticipates serving around 20 participating libraries through a cost-effective, community-driven shared infrastructure. This model strengthens SCELC’s role as a technology partner and expands access to innovative, sustainable library solutions.
FOLIO (“The Future of Libraries is Open”) is a modern, open-source library services platform built for flexibility, collaboration, and innovation. FOLIO is seeing rapid adoption by the library community, including consortial implementations and the Library of Congress.

Participating libraries enjoy the following services:
Implementation project management – Coordinated migration to FOLIO with SCELC support.
Configuration and customization – Tailoring the system to local needs in consultation with participating libraries.
Training and onboarding – Preparing staff to use the platform effectively.
Central system administration – Ongoing technical management and updates of the central tenant.
Helpdesk support – Direct assistance for troubleshooting and questions.
Ongoing development – Engagement in FOLIO’s open-source community to influence future features.
Governance and collaboration – A SCELC Steering Committee will ensure members have a voice in program direction.
SCELC FOLIO is open to SCELC Member libraries of all sizes, with particular benefits for smaller and under-resourced institutions seeking next-generation library technology without the overhead of local system management.
